This bibliometric analysis explores Islamic business ethics and corporate social responsibility (CSR) in the context of Islamic banking, as well as the practical implications and impacts of technology on sustainable development. The analysis of data collected from scientific publications between 2015 and 2024 shows a significant increasing trend in the number of publications and citations related to this theme. This study identifies three main clusters in the literature, namely Islamic business ethics, social responsibility, and technology in Islamic banking, which show an interconnected relationship in promoting sustainability. These findings emphasize the importance of adopting the latest technology in strengthening sustainable Islamic banking practices, as well as encouraging financial institutions to consider social, environmental, and Shariah-compliant aspects in their operations. Thus, this study provides guidance for academics and practitioners in developing insights and policies in a more inclusive and sustainable Islamic banking sector.
